cmd下,如何在文本的指定行添加内容
参考出处:http://bbs.wuyou.com/forum.php?mod=viewthread&tid=202142&page=1
第二行和倒数第二行插入新的一行(内容123)
-----------------------------分割线--------------------------------
@echo off
setlocal ENABLEDELAYEDEXPANSION
set n=0
set aa=0
for /f "delims=" %%a in (c:\abc.txt) do set /a n=!n!+1
for /f "delims=" %%a in (c:\abc.txt) do (
set /a aa=!aa!+1
set /a n=!n!-1
echo %%a >>c:\tmp.txt
if !aa!==1 echo 123 >>c:\tmp.txt
if !n!==1 echo 123 >>c:\tmp.txt
)
del /q c:\abc.txt
ren c:\tmp.txt abc.txt
pause
-----------------------------分割线--------------------------------
如果只是添加123而不是插入新行,方法类似。比如在第二行和倒数第二行开头添加123:
-----------------------------分割线--------------------------------
@echo off
setlocal ENABLEDELAYEDEXPANSION
set n=0
set aa=0
for /f "delims=" %%a in (c:\abc.txt) do (
set /a aa=!aa!+1
if !aa!==2 (echo 123%%a >>c:\tmp.txt) else echo %%a >>c:\tmp.txt
)
for /f "delims=" %%a in (c:\tmp.txt) do set /a n=!n!+1
for /f "delims=" %%a in (c:\tmp.txt) do (
set /a n=!n!-1
if !n!==1 (echo 123%%a >>c:\tmp1.txt) else echo %%a >>c:\tmp1.txt
)
del /q c:\abc.txt
del /q c:\tmp.txt
ren c:\tmp1.txt abc.txt
pause
-----------------------------分割线--------------------------------
转载于:https://www.cnblogs.com/IntelligentBrain/p/5111341.html
cmd下,如何在文本的指定行添加内容相关推荐
- 如何用python读取文本中指定行的内容
如何用python读取文本中指定行的内容 搜索资料 我来答 分享 新浪微博 QQ空间 浏览 5284 次 查看全文 http://www.taodudu.cc/news/show-64036.ht ...
- linux在指定行添加内容,linux下利用shell在指定的行添加内容的方法
linux下利用shell在指定的行添加内容的方法 在linux的一些配置中总会要进行某个文件中的某行的操作,进行增加,修改,删除等操作. 而这里主要是进行的是指定的行添加数据的操作: 脚本如下: s ...
- python向文档中输入内容_Python修改文件往指定行插入内容的实例
需求:批量修改py文件中的类属性,为类增加一个core = True新的属性 原py文件如下 a.py class A(): description = "abc" 现在有一个1. ...
- python怎么读文件里的某一行-Python如何获取文件指定行的内容
linecache, 可以用它方便地获取某一文件某一行的内容.而且它也被 traceback 模块用来获取相关源码信息来展示. 用法很简单: >>> import linecache ...
- 请教大家,如何使用sed命令,替换文件指定行的内容呢?-Linux系统管理-ChinaUnix.net...
请教大家,如何使用sed命令,替换文件指定行的内容呢?-Linux系统管理-ChinaUnix.net
- jtable如何从表格中定位_ja中怎样将一个JTable表中的指定行添加到数据库
公告: 为响应国家净网行动,部分内容已经删除,感谢读者理解. 话题:ja中怎样将一个JTable表中的指定行添加到数据库用的是回答:你首先得获取你选择的指定行 (getselectrow()方法),再 ...
- 【C++】读取txt文件中指定行的内容
使用c++读取TXT文件中指定行的内容 classification_classes_ILSVRC2012.txt:下载链接 验证: #include <iostream> #includ ...
- java大文件首行追加,java中实现,在大文件的第一行添加内容
需求描述: 最近在写一个定时任务,发送多次请求到接口,接口返回报文写入到一个文件中,文件要求格式第一行为总数.这个总数只能在最后的时候才能知道, 这就相当于提出了一个要求:在文件的第一行添加内容,以前 ...
- 文本超过指定行数显示折叠、展开按钮并以三个点结束
需求 一段从接口获取到的文本,要求显示时,如果长度超过指定行数,则以三个点省略后面内容,并出现"全文"按钮,点击后显示全文,"全文"按钮变成"收起&q ...
最新文章
- python计算wav的语谱图_Python实现电脑录音(含音频基础知识讲解)
- 获取访问者的IP地址
- Spark学习之路 (十五)SparkCore的源码解读(一)启动脚本
- 有关T-SQL的10个好习惯
- Insufficient free space for journal files
- 关于共享单车,说点什么
- kafka是什么_终于知道Kafka为什么这么快了!
- how to find the original page containing a given image
- 解决org.apache.hadoop.io.nativeio.NativeIOException: 当文件已存在时,无法创建该文件。
- 视频PPT互动问答丨数据库智能运维专题
- docker运行dubbo-admin
- 学校如何把表格里的成绩,让学生以二维码的方式去扫描查询呢?
- 敏捷开发绩效管理之五:敏捷开发生产率(上)(故事点估算)
- 大学计算机基础知识说课,计算机基础说课课件
- 科密考勤机RS485接头接线方法和加班计算公式
- 苹果手机使用技巧汇总,手把手教你如何快速使用苹果手机
- K - Assigning Frequencies
- python一切皆对象 对象都有类_Python小世界:彻底搞懂Python一切皆对象!!!
- Vue2.5从零开发猫眼④——Home页开发
- tensorflow tf.tile 使用教程·
热门文章
- Win7环境下VS2010配置Cocos2d-x-2.1.4最新版本的开发环境(亲测)
- Android之Providing Resources(提供资源)
- 设计模式学习—Strategy(策略)
- DataList编辑、更新、取消、删除、分页(分页控件 AspNetPager.dll)
- jQuery UI Autocomplete示例(一)
- Swift项目,超美的动画和tableView,collectionView,轮播图的使用,网络请求的封装等
- 以Attribute加上Header验证
- python (3.5)字符串 持续更新中………………
- c++ 多线程 垃圾回收器_JVM的垃圾回收机制 总结(垃圾收集、回收算法、垃圾回收器)...
- POJ2709 染料贪心